Some \(I\)-convergent multiplier double classes of sequences of fuzzy numbers defined by Orlicz functions. (English) Zbl 1306.40002

Summary: In this paper using ideal \(I\) and Orlicz function \(M\) together with a general multiplier double sequence \(\Lambda = (\lambda_{nk})\), \(n, k \in\mathbb N\) of non-zero real numbers, we introduce some new type of \(I\)-convergent fuzzy real-valued double sequence spaces. We have studied different topological properties of these sequence spaces. Also we have characterized the multiplier problem and some inclusion relations involving these classes of sequences are obtained. Further some equivalent statements involving these classes of sequences are established.
